POWER THEORY – Announces Addition Of Second Guitarist; Local Live Dates Announced
Philadelphia-based Trad Metal band Power Theory would like to welcome renowned Metal guitarist Steve Stegg, into our family as our newest band member. Steve is a founding member and former guitarist for Blood Feast, Sleepy Hollow, and Tapping the Vein.
“Power Theory has been looking to add a second dual rhythm/lead guitarist since the end of the recording sessions for An Axe to Grind, but our commitments haven’t given us the time to do anything but start to compile a list of potential candidates,” guitarist Bob “BB” Ballinger explained.
“Steve is a great friend and supporter of the band, and has been a regular at our local shows; in fact he replaced me as the Colossus guitarist and played with Jay Pekala prior to his first Sleepy Hollow tenure. We would always jokingly added Steve as our top candidate when we discussed it, but knew he was very busy with Sleepy Hollow and there was no chance, so we moved on to other names” added BB. “Steve informed us he had become available in mid July and was interested in jamming to see if there was chemistry and it was evident from the first few minutes it was a great fit for both Power Theory and Steve.”

“We will then take a short break from live shows to start demo tracking for a new full length CD we are planning to start recording in February 2013 and release in 2013 as well. We are currently negotiating with a legendary artist/producer for the project (more to come soon on that). Steve will be a very big part of the writing and recording process for the new album, and we will resume some live shows in October 2012. European dates are being planned for 2013 with Red Lion Music as well as Warriors of Metal Fest VI, and some US tour dates with Axxenstar and Taberah for summer 2013.”
Power Theory released An Axe to Grind on June 29th via Pure Steel Records. The album is available at http://www.powertheory.net
